What is the DPF ( Diesel Particle Filter)?

Most diesel passenger cars, vans and commercial vehicles built after 2006 have a DPF filter

installed in the exhaust system.

Peugeot , Citroen have had them installed from 2001 together with an additive system

The filter is designed to reduce the soot particles from engine combustion from

entering the atmosphere.

What it does?...

the filter works by trapping the soot in a ceramic filter membrane and then using

both passive and active regeneration to keep the filter clean.

Eventually all filters will clog up as they have an expected lifetime and are

a service item not covered by warranty.

They average approx £1000 to replace including labour and can be as much as £3000.
